Rescue Incident - Minto Heights
Published: 02 Apr 2021 12:20pm
Fire and Rescue NSW (FRNSW) are in attendance at a serious rock climber which has fallen in off Duncan Street, Minto Heights
Crews have located the rock climber in very difficult terrain and Ambulance NSW are assessing the patient's injuries.
All agencies are working together to sort out the safest extrication technique
Fire and Rescue NSW are setting up vertical rescue equipment to retrieve the patient
The patient has been retrieved via FRNSW vertical rescue team and multi-agency hauling party. Treated and transported to hospital with Ambulance NSW
